Going back to the 1920's to the 1940's, when glamor was made fabulous by such names as Gloria Swanson, Joan Crawford, Mary Pickford, Judy Garland (yes, Judy too!) - let's be honest, I could write a book that included stars he outfitted with shoes - but the point is the very inventor of the cork wedge made it for starlets. They were dazzling and chic for the time. (Main reason being that leather and wood were in full reserve during the wartime, cork - not so much.) Presto, chango, ala ... yeah, poof - we'll just go with 'poof', the platform cork wedge was born.
Now, fast forward nearly a hundred years, and they're back in style. Not just in style, but in everyday style. They aren't for - they aren't only for - the red carpet.
